通貨を変換するC++アプリケーションの書き方

ページ名:通貨を変換するC__アプリケーションの書き方

C++でプログラミング・スキルを練習するためのプロジェクトをお探しですか?このチュートリアルでは、通貨を変換するC++プログラムの書き方を紹介します。

  • 1
    Microsoft Visual Studioをダウンロードする。visualstudio.microsoft.comにアクセスし、Visual StudioのCommunityバージョンをダウンロードして、C++ Currency Converterの作成を開始します。
  • 2
    Visual Studioを開き、プロジェクトを作成します。
  • 3
    ソース・ファイルに .cpp を追加して、コーディングを開始します。
  • 4
    ライブラリーとネームスペースを宣言する。すべてを確実に実行するために、consio.h、cstdlib、fstream、iomanip、iostream、stringをインクルードする必要があります。
    #include #include ; #include ; #include ; #include ; #include ; using namespace std;
  • 5
    コードを書き込むメイン関数を作成する。メイン関数の中にすべてのコードを書く。
    int main() { }.
  • 6
    Double変数を宣言する。C++のように、USDとRateをdoubleにし、通貨レートを宣言する。 Doubleは実数を格納する。
    double usd; double rate; double euro; rate = 0.85;
  • 7
    2つの列を宣言する。ラベルを右寄せにし、値を左寄せにした2つの列を作成する。
    const int COLMFT1 = 35; const int COLMFT2 = 15;
  • 8
    実数をフォーマットする。小数点以下の桁数を制限するには、setprecisionを使用します。この例では、setを使用して小数点以下の桁数を2に設定します。
    cout << fixed << setprecision(2);
  • 9
    通貨コンバーターにユーザーを歓迎するアプリケーションヘッダを追加します。例:"C++通貨コンバーターへようこそ"
    cout << ""C++ Currency Converterへようこそ" << endl;
  • 10
    ユーザーの入力を促すcout文とcin文を使って、ユーザーに情報の入力を促しましょう。
    cout << setw(COLMFT1) << left << "値(米ドル)を入力してください:"; cin >> usd; cout << endl;
  • 11
    ユーザー入力を画面に表示する。入力されたユーザー番号を画面に表示する
    cout << setw(COLMFT1) << left << "米ドル:"; cout << setw(COLMFT1) << right << usd << endl;


  • 12
    通貨の換算レートを画面に表示する。例:1米ドル=0.85ユーロ
    cout << setw(COLMFT1) << left << "換算レート(米ドルあたり):"; cout << setw(COLMFT1) << right << rate << endl;


  • 13
    与えられた数値をレートで計算する。
    ユーロ = USD * レート;
  • 14
    変換後の通貨を表示する。
  • 15
    アプリケーションにクロージングステートメントを追加する。アプリケーションに終了文を追加するには、cout 文を使用します。
    cout << "レートコンバータ終了" << endl; cout << "レートコンバータ終了" << endl;
  • 16
    Windows デバッガを実行し、アプリケーションが正しく実行されていることを確認する。ローカル Windows デバッガ」をクリックするか、キーボードの F5 キーを押してアプリケーションを実行してください。


  • この記事は、CC BY-NC-SAの下で公開されている " How to Write a C++ Application that Converts Currency " を改変して作成しました。特に断りのない限り、CC BY-NC-SAの下で利用可能です。

    シェアボタン: このページをSNSに投稿するのに便利です。

    コメント

    返信元返信をやめる

    ※ 悪質なユーザーの書き込みは制限します。

    最新を表示する

    NG表示方式

    NGID一覧